FCC Moves to Speed Up Cell Tower App Processing
The FCC has established time frames of 90 days for collocations and 150 days for state and local processing of tower-siting applications. The FCC was acting on a Petition for Declaratory Ruling clarifying provisions in the Communications Act regarding state and local review of wireless facility- siting applications, which was filed by CTIA - The Wireless Association. Tower Deal Signals Healthy M&A Market
In a positive sign for the tower M&A market, American Tower has purchased 196 towers from Cincinnati Bell for $100 million. The towers, which are located in Ohio and Kentucky, average 2.1 tenants, will be leased back by the carrier. MORE

Local Governments Object to Tower Siting Ruling
The National Association of Telecommunications Officers and Advisors has announced that it will file a Petition for Reconsideration in response to the FCC's "shot clock" tower siting ruling, which requires state and local jurisdictions to process applications within 150 days and collocations within 90 days. Virginia County Looks to Map Wireless Infrastructure
The County of Chesterfield, Va., is looking to be prepared for the next application to develop a cell tower. The municipality, south of Richmond, is creating a map and a database of all of the cell towers in the county and the carriers providing service on each. The database will hopefully answer questions like, "Are there any possibilities to collocate the antenna?" MORE
Fine for Inaccurate Coordinates is Reduced
The FCC has slightly reduced the monetary forfeiture that it had assessed to Media Logic from $4,000 to $3,200 for failing to operate its aural studio-transmitter-link at the licensed location. MORE

Circular Connector
Amphenol Industrial has introduced Star-Line EX, a line of RoHS-compliant, rugged connectors that provide up to 1,500 amps in signal, control and power applications. The rugged connectors are certified for use in Zone 1-llc hazardous environments and features a dielectric strength of 1,800 volts and heat resistance up to 750 degrees Fahrenheit. Solder, crimp or pressure terminals eliminate the need for hard wiring to terminal blocks enclosed in junction boxes. The Star-Line EX also features stainless steel, brass and aluminum housings. www.amphenol-industrial.com

CorningMulti-fiber Connectors
Corning's environmentally-hardened OptiTip multi-fiber connectors are able to withstand temperature extremes, vibration, dust penetration and prolonged water submersion. The connectors are designed for rapid deployment of roof-top and tower-based cellular equipment. Their optical loss levels rival traditional fusion splicing. A small footprint allows them to be installed in either open environments or ducts as tight as one inch. Components equipped with Corning's OptiTip connector are lighter, smaller and can be installed in less time than traditional optical products, making them particularly well-suited for tower environments.  www.corning.com/cablesystems
